Starz Encore Westerns (Pacific)

Starz Encore Westerns (Pacific) is a cable channel in the United States dedicated to the Western genre. Its programming focuses on classic and contemporary cowboy films, frontier dramas, and related television series, drawing from a library of titles that spans several decades. Viewers can expect to see movies featuring iconic actors of the genre, as well as lesser-known B-Westerns and serials. The channel’s content is commercial-free, allowing uninterrupted viewing of its scheduled films and shows. It serves as a destination for those interested in stories set in the American Old West, including tales of outlaws, lawmen, cattle drives, and settlement life.

In addition to its linear broadcast, the channel is accessible through the Starz app and various streaming platforms for subscribers. The Pacific feed refers to the time zone version that aligns with the West Coast schedule, meaning programming airs three hours later than the Eastern feed. TV guide listings for the channel can be found through most cable and satellite providers, as well as online program directories. The channel does not produce original content or host live events, instead relying on its existing film and television catalog to fill its daily schedule.
